Etiquette

Etiquette

  • Possession of the rink
    • Belongs to the player or team whose bowl is being played until it comes to rest, then possession is transferred to the opponent
    • Players who follow their bowl up the rink must be beyond the head before their bowl comes to rest
    • The player in possession of the mat should not be interfered with, annoyed or distracted in any way, e.g. by talking to them
  • Position of the players
    • Mat end – players not delivering the bowl should stand at least 1 metre behind the mat
    • Head end – the team in possession of the rink should be behind the head, the team not in possession should stand behind and away from the head
  • Movement off the green
    • Anyone moving around the green should stop when in the eyeline of players about to deliver their bowl
    • Spectators should not give any advice to players or disturb the play
